Transaction 8d9588698a7700fa81f6622e0a33547fc41f8465315f9b2a18e110a159dc9d78
1 Input
1 Output
-
8d9588698a7700fa81f6622e0a33547fc41f8465315f9b2a18e110a159dc9d78:0
- value
- 1202134
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 733536fdadcb6d06f12b771c6689b5c188d395e6 OP_EQUAL
- address
- 3CCBP2vUkGDGQJuFGvfAi25XKfMjuDy5ge